Sudowoodo

Sudowoodo in Pokémon Infinite Fusion

#185 · Rock · see locations below

Rock

Abilities

Sturdy, Rock Head, Rattled (hidden)

Base stats

HP70
Attack100
Defense115
Sp. Attack30
Sp. Defense65
Speed30
Total410

Compared with the official games

Its stats, type and abilities match the official games — this hack leaves them alone. Its level-up moves and TM list may still differ; those are listed above.

Other changes in this hack

  • Egg moves: Curse, Defense Curl, Endure, Harden, Headbutt, Rollout, Sand Tomb, Self-Destruct, Stealth Rock
